At Turion Space, we’re building spacecraft to secure Earth and expand humanity’s reach beyond it. As part of our Mechanical Engineering team, you’ll help design and build the satellites and mechanisms that make our missions possible.

As a Staff Mechanical Engineer, you’ll work across the full development lifecycle from early concept and detailed design through analysis, fabrication, integration, and testing. You’ll collaborate closely with a multidisciplinary team to deliver flight hardware that is robust, reliable, and ready for space.

This is a full-time, exempt position based at our Irvine, California headquarters.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design metallic structures and propulsion fluid systems under accelerated timelines

  • Review specifications and other engineering data to develop mechanical systems

  • Update designs and drawings through engineering change orders to support our rapid pace of design iteration

  • Create detailed component and assembly drawings incorporating an understanding of GD&T and tolerance stack-ups

  • Lead, mentor, and train engineers

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or's Degree in an engineering discipline

  • 8+ years of mechanical design and drafting experience

  • Experience with 3D CAD software (SolidWorks preferred)

  • Deep understanding and application of GD&T and tolerance stack-ups

  • Extensive spacecraft design experience

  • Must be able to obtain and maintain a Secret and/or a TS/SCI clearance.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Hands-on experience working on teams designing hardware in a highly constrained system under defined timelines

  • Experience working on aluminum and composite materials

  • Familiarity with welded structures and fluid systems

  • Ability to manage large assembly models and drawings

  • Ability to work and communicate well with minimal supervision

  • Creative problem solver that can bring multiple disciplines together to achieve buy-in for a unified design direction

  • Self-motivated with strong multi-tasking, organizational, communication, and documentation skills

ITAR Requirements:

This position may include access to technology and/or software source code that is subject to U.S. export controls. To conform to U.S. Government export regulations, applicant must be a (i) U.S. citizen or national, (ii) U.S. lawful, permanent resident (aka green card holder), (iii) Refugee under 8 U.S.C. § 1157, or (iv) Asylee under 8 U.S.C. § 1158, or be eligible to obtain the required authorizations from the U.S. Department of State.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
